About PGDSE

PGDSE stands for Post Graduate Diploma in Software Engineering. It is a professional course designed to provide advanced knowledge of programming, software development, database management, web technologies, software testing, and project development.

This course is ideal for graduates, IT students, job seekers, and professionals who want to build a strong career in the software and IT industry. PGDSE focuses on both theoretical concepts and practical implementation required for real-world software development.
